The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Richard Booth, born in 1853 in Salford, consisted of 5 members. Richard was the head of the household, married to Ellen Booth, born in 1855 in Mirfield, Yorkshire, England. They had 3 children; Amelia (born 1876 in Leeds, Yorkshire, England), William (born 1878 in Leeds, Yorkshire, England) and James Gibbs (born 1881 in Stalybridge, Lancashire, England).
